I went through a bit of this myself before getting the XD 45. I went to a store that also has a range & tried a few different XD's & XDM's. I like the looks of the XD 45 service model because of the barrel to frame ratio, & I like the caliber because if your going to the range your going because you want to have fun, & what's more fun, the smaller caliber or the hand cannon? I'd find a range that has the guns your interested in available for rent & go try them out.
 
Have you looking into getting a Sig Sauer? I'm a critic of 9mm for the stopping power. I have used it when it mattered and had to fire 7 shots that were all hits to knock the guy down. Some will argue that government issue FMJ ammunition is garbage and I will not disagree but it completely soured me on 9mm. My .45 is a Sig P220 and that in my opinion is the perfect gun. It's accurate out to 50m and I do have 100m hits with it but I do need a bit of hold off. http://www.sigsauer.com/CatalogProductList/pistols-p220.aspx Sig also makes the P250 that allows you to change out the caliber and frame with very little work. http://www.sigsauer.com/CatalogProductList/pistols-p250.aspx It is mainly going to come down to what you feel more comfortable with.
